The Xeon L5520 is manufactured by Intel. It was released in 30 March 2009 (16 years ago). It is based on the Gainestown (2009−2010) architecture. It features 4 cores and 8 threads. Base frequency is 2.26 GHz, with boost up to 2.48 GHz. L3 cache: 8 MB (total). L2 cache: 256 kB (per core). Built on 45 nm process technology. Socket: LGA1366. Thermal design power (TDP): 60 Watt. Memory support: DDR3. Passmark benchmark score: 2,274 points. Launch price was $100.
